Nail polishing has become a key part of cosmetic routines for many people. Through different techniques, achieving perfect nails has become simple. Starting with simple polishing to more advanced designs, people have many ways to get perfect results.

One of the best-known nail polishing techniques is the classic solid color method. This technique involves prepping the nails with the application of a initial coat to ensure a smooth surface for the lacquer. Following this step, a thin coat of color is painted over the nails, subsequently a sealing coat to protect the color. This technique is easy but delivers elegant and stylish results.

An additional widely practiced nail art method is the French style. This approach starts with applying a soft base color over the nail, then adding a thin light-colored line across the end of the nail. The French manicure is recognized for a polished and sophisticated look, this makes it popular for elegant occasions. Creating a flawless French tip requires a high level of skill and practice, though the results are worth it.

Stamping nail art is a fun and accessible method of decorating nails where you to create intricate patterns with ease. This method involves using a patterned tool that features engraved designs. Once you’ve applied color to the engraved area, then you apply a stamper to lift the design and stamp it onto your nails. Stamping is great for those new to nail art looking for detailed designs without the effort involved for freehand Claresa Bronzer TANNED drawing.

Fade techniques are another unique polishing method that results in a faded design across the nails. This approach involves applying two or more hues of nail polish onto the nail, producing a smooth fade from one hue to another. It’s possible to using a makeup sponge to dab the shades onto the nail. To get a flawless result, it's important to seal the design with a finishing layer, which also eliminate any harsh lines. Gradient nails work best for achieving a stylish and artistic finish.

If you want a more complex nail art design, freehand nail art provide unlimited options. This technique includes applying fine brushes to paint unique patterns by hand on the nails. Whether you choose floral designs, this approach gives you total freedom over the finished product. Although it takes greater precision, the finished product can be stunning and completely unique. Adding a protective layer is important to protect the polish and add durability.
